Several environmental factors determine how often a home should be pressure-washed. Local climate, nearby vegetation, and ambient pollution levels accelerate surface soiling and the buildup of contaminants on exterior materials.
Charleston's humid subtropical climate accelerates mold, mildew, and algae accumulation on exterior surfaces. These organisms thrive in moist conditions and can degrade siding, roofing, and decking if not removed. Warmer temperatures further promote biological growth, increasing the required maintenance frequency.

Moisture Problems & Exterior Damage in Humid Climates
This publication provides design criteria to prevent and remediate moisture problems in air-conditioned buildings in humid climates. Identified issues include: 1) mold and mildew on exterior building surfaces; 2) peeling, blistering, flaking and bleeding of paint on exterior and interior surfaces; 3) interior odor; 4) uncomfortably high levels of interior humidity; 5) property damage resulting from condensation in and on building walls and roofs; and 6) insulation losses resulting from condensation within building walls and roofs.

Establishing a pressure washing schedule is essential for preserving exterior materials. Frequency should reflect site-specific conditions and the current condition of surfaces.
Most Charleston residences should receive at least one professional pressure washing annually. Properties with dense vegetation or frequent heavy rainfall often benefit from semiannual cleanings. Periodic visual assessments will indicate whether more frequent interventions are necessary. For comprehensive exterior care, house washing services can be tailored to your needs.
Spring and fall are generally the most suitable seasons for pressure washing in Charleston. Mild temperatures during these periods allow effective cleaning without rapid drying that can cause streaking. Spring cleaning prepares the exterior for summer, while fall cleaning removes accumulated debris prior to winter.

Yes. Incorrect pressure settings or improper technique can strip paint, damage siding, or break windows. To prevent harm, select appropriate pressure levels and nozzles for each surface. Hiring experienced professionals ensures correct methods and equipment are used to minimize risk.
Prepare by removing outdoor furniture, decorations, and plants from the work area. Close all windows and doors to prevent water entry. Cover electrical outlets and sensitive equipment. Clear loose debris to allow for an efficient and thorough cleaning operation.
Pressure washing is not appropriate for all materials. Hard surfaces such as concrete, brick, and vinyl siding tolerate higher pressures. Softer materials—wood, stucco, or painted surfaces—require lower pressures or alternative cleaning methods. Inspect surface materials beforehand and consult a professional to determine the proper approach. For roof surfaces, specialized roof cleaning services are recommended.
Duration depends on home size, the degree of soiling, and the types of surfaces. Typical residential jobs range from one to three hours. Larger homes or more complex tasks will require additional time. A consultation with a professional provides a tailored time estimate.
If mold or mildew persists after cleaning, the initial treatment may have been insufficient or site conditions may favor regrowth. Apply a purpose-designed mold and mildew remover formulated for exterior use, improve ventilation where feasible, and reduce persistent moisture in shaded areas. Implement regular maintenance inspections to prevent recurrence.

Those black streaks on your roof are not just dirt. They are a living organism called Gloeocapsa Magma. It feeds on your shingles, traps heat, and can contribute to long-term roof wear. Using high pressure to blast it away can make the problem worse by stripping away the protective granules that help shield the roof.
Feeds on the limestone filler in shingles and spreads across visible roof surfaces.
Dark streaks trap more heat, hurt curb appeal, and can leave the roof looking aged fast.
High-pressure cleaning can strip protective granules and create even bigger roofing problems.
